The system has been developed to meet three key requirements

  • Removal of firing deposits
  • Removal of inhibiting oil
  • Application of oil to a cleaned barrel

Its fast and effective one-man operation enables the operator to clean a large calibre weapon system in less than five minutes.

Bore Cleaning System for Small Gauge

This system is suitable for barrels between 20 mm and 40 mm. The filter lubricator can be located in the lid of the container and no foot valve is necessary. A carry bag can be supplied as an alternative and depending on the type of deposit, a selection of brushes and accessories are available. Application with the distribution brush ensures that the minimum amount of fluid is used to achieve the maximum results. Application is fast and can be repeated as many times as necessary within a short space of time.

Bore Cleaning System for Large Gauge

This system is available for barrels from the size of 57mm to 203mm. A free standing filter lubricator is supplied along with a foot valve. A carry bag can be supplied as an alternative and depending on the type of deposit, a selection of brushes and accessories are available.

Brushes available are:

Cleaning – with steel tufts for a deep clean in all rifled and smooth bore barrels
Squeegee – which has rubber blades for removal of oil or preservatives
Oiling – for applying oil or fluid to the barrel
Distributing – for depositing oil or CCS (Copper Control Solution) along the length of the barrel by prefilling the fluid into a chamber inside the brush for even and thorough distribution.

A brush designed for cleaning mortar weapons is available that ensures the protection of the firing pin and a thorough clean throughout the barrel. Brushes to clean the chamber section of the barrel are also available for most sizes.
